Transaction 169609a3d373b3c2264a1c53a5afcf292f1da113217f4a597826483f6b0caf5d
1 Input
1 Output
-
169609a3d373b3c2264a1c53a5afcf292f1da113217f4a597826483f6b0caf5d:0
- value
- 77356875
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4b8ae05b422f86784b1cb6e560a82da170391777 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17tS3gv6DxgXCm2dmsMBYWKoiK2Z5ZsECP